What Is Weight Loss Surgery?
Weight loss surgery, also known as bariatric surgery, involves surgical procedures that help individuals with obesity lose weight by altering the digestive system. The most common types include gastric bypass, sleeve gastrectomy, and adjustable gastric banding. These procedures reduce the size of the stomach or change the way food is absorbed, helping patients feel fuller with less food, which leads to significant weight loss over time.
How Does Surgery Help Overcome Obesity?
1. Significant Weight Loss
The primary benefit of bariatric surgery is the significant and sustained weight loss it can provide. By limiting food intake and changing how your body absorbs nutrients, you’ll lose weight at a faster and more consistent rate compared to traditional methods. This weight loss can help reduce or eliminate health risks associated with obesity, including diabetes, high blood pressure, and heart disease.
2. Improved Health Conditions
Obesity is often linked to other health conditions, such as type 2 diabetes, sleep apnea, and joint pain. 4. Long-Term Results
Unlike quick-fix diets, surgical interventions offer long-term results. However, it’s important to note that successful results depend on adopting a healthy lifestyle post-surgery. This includes maintaining a balanced diet, exercising regularly, and attending follow-up appointments. The procedure is not a cure-all, but it provides a strong foundation for sustained weight loss when combined with healthy habits.
